<p>Leadership is an absolute requirement in any effort involving a group of people if the goal is to move forward or attain something instead letting chaos to prevail. Team members, or employees in a work group, may have specific roles to perform or part of the goal to be accomplished but a leader is always needed to perform a role greatly akin to the conductor of an orchestra that is composed of veteran musicians. Team work creates a very positive environment, enhanced further by the leadership abilities of its leader. Team work makes the members of the group feel that they are important elements in the &#8220;grand scheme&#8221; of thing, not merely an unimportant employee who is there for the fast buck.<br />
<span id="more-111"></span><br />
In a cleaning business, team leadership is very important. Regardless of the size of your cleaning business, the employees must recognize the leadership and authority of the person who is guiding them through their work. Your role then, as a leader, must be clearly defined. You have to make sure that the goal of the team will be effectively carried out and accomplished in the shortest time possible but with the greatest degree of result. This will require the availability of supplies and materials, proper training of the team members, reliable equipment and the ability to handle them properly, and the support and confidence on the team members.</p>
<p>As a team leader, you should help every team member develop his potential through proper training and motivation. Make the members of the team feel that you trust them on their ability to get the work done. Make them feel that they are really part of the team by delegating them assignments and responsibilities and let them be comfortable in the decisions they have to make. You should not let any barrier stand between you and the team members by opening the lines of communications within the team.</p>
<p>Building a good team starts from the hiring process. Interpersonal skills must be an important factor in hiring an employee to be a member of the team. An employee who is unable to relate with other workers has no place in a team that relies on members&#8217; contribution to carry out its goals. Such kind of employee will surely become a stumbling block for the team&#8217;s efforts at getting their job done.</p>
<p>After hiring a group of people who can work effectively as part of the team, a leader&#8217;s main task is the actual building of the team. The leader needs first to set the goals and priorities. There must be a clearly defined objective and a set of priorities in attaining such objective. Then the leader must create a list of tasks and distribute them to the members of the team who are in the best position to carry each out.</p>
<p>The team leader should make a study of how the different members who have their own tasks can work in harmony in attaining the main objective. Relationship among the members should be clearly established, making sure that there is an open line of communication between each members.</p>
<p>Team building seminars conducted on a regular basis can help promote better cooperation among the members of the team. This is going to enhance your role as a team leader of your cleaning business.</p>
